anvil.server
Class Context

java.lang.Object
  |
  +--anvil.server.Context

public class Context
extends java.lang.Object

class Context


Constructor Summary
Context(Address address, java.lang.String resource)
           
 
Method Summary
 Session createSession()
           
 RequestAdapter getAdapter()
           
 Address getAddress()
           
 Citizen getCitizen()
           
 java.lang.String getHostname()
           
 Session getOrCreateSession(java.lang.String id)
           
 java.lang.String getOriginalPathinfo()
           
 java.io.OutputStream getOutputStream()
           
 java.lang.String getPathinfo()
           
 javax.servlet.http.HttpServletRequest getRequest()
           
 java.lang.String getResource()
           
 javax.servlet.http.HttpServletResponse getResponse()
           
 Server getServer()
           
 Session getSession()
           
 Session getSession(java.lang.String session_id)
           
 java.lang.String getSessionId()
           
 Zone getZone()
           
 Log log()
           
 void setCitizen(Citizen citizen)
           
 void setResource(java.lang.String resource)
           
 void setSession(Session session)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

Context

public Context(Address address,
               java.lang.String resource)
Method Detail

log

public Log log()

getOutputStream

public java.io.OutputStream getOutputStream()
                                     throws java.io.IOException
java.io.IOException

getAddress

public Address getAddress()

getServer

public Server getServer()

getHostname

public java.lang.String getHostname()

getPathinfo

public java.lang.String getPathinfo()

getOriginalPathinfo

public java.lang.String getOriginalPathinfo()

getAdapter

public RequestAdapter getAdapter()

getResource

public java.lang.String getResource()

setResource

public void setResource(java.lang.String resource)

getZone

public Zone getZone()

getRequest

public javax.servlet.http.HttpServletRequest getRequest()

getResponse

public javax.servlet.http.HttpServletResponse getResponse()

getSessionId

public java.lang.String getSessionId()

getSession

public Session getSession()

setSession

public void setSession(Session session)

setCitizen

public void setCitizen(Citizen citizen)

getCitizen

public Citizen getCitizen()

getSession

public Session getSession(java.lang.String session_id)

createSession

public Session createSession()

getOrCreateSession

public Session getOrCreateSession(java.lang.String id)